Output 6ae9dba16072a0e4beb859048aa442e6a90acb3f66dcf40b17d7886472bfa4d3:0

value
530160815
script pubkey
OP_0 OP_PUSHBYTES_20 d66835a4f3c6dc6f37b52fb35e36094feff37d4f
address
bc1q6e5rtf8ncmwx7da497e4udsfflhlxl20gysqfg
transaction
6ae9dba16072a0e4beb859048aa442e6a90acb3f66dcf40b17d7886472bfa4d3
spent
true